GoFundMe is looking for a dynamic and strategic Director of Talent Acquisition to lead, evolve, and scale our hiring engine, both in the U.S. and globally. In this high-impact role, you’ll shape how we attract, engage, and hire top talent to fuel our mission of helping people help each other. You’ll bring a bold vision for recruiting, deep expertise in talent strategy, and a strong ability to influence, inspire, and operationalize.

We are seeking candidates based in the Bay Area who can come to the office 2+ times per week.

The Job

  • Guide, mentor, and grow the global Talent Acquisition team into trusted advisors to the business, fostering a culture of collaboration, curiosity, and excellence.
  • Align all hiring stakeholders around a cohesive process, ensuring clarity, accountability, and urgency in securing world-class talent.
  • Collaborate closely with department leaders to proactively understand and respond to evolving team and company needs.
  • Refine and scale recruiting strategies, tools, and workflows to ensure we’re operating efficiently and effectively, without sacrificing quality or experience.
  • Continuously improve the candidate and hiring manager experience by capturing feedback, identifying pain points, and optimizing each stage of the funnel.
  • Define and track meaningful metrics to monitor funnel health, hiring velocity, pipeline diversity, conversion rates, and team performance.
  • Partner with Finance to forecast, track, and report on hiring progress and headcount planning, ensuring alignment with budget and business priorities.
  • Lead inclusive hiring practices and keep us on track to meet our internal goals for building a diverse, representative team.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to build and promote a compelling Employee Value Proposition and employer brand that reflects our culture and attracts the right talent.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ant employment laws and regulations.

You 

  •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ent
  • 10+ years of relevant experience
  • 5+ years of proven experience leading, aligning, and developing recruiting teams within a high-growth tech industry
  • Experience managing a global recruiting team in a competitive tech industry  
  • Deep understanding of the complexity of diversity recruiting, and desire to drive results
  • Process improvement mindset. You have an eye for efficiency, never losing sight of quality
  • Demonstrated experience leveraging data to drive TA strategy, processes, and programs  
  • Ability to navigate ambiguity, adapt quickly to shifting priorities, make timely decisions, and drive behavioral change
  • Problem solver with the ability to switch seamlessly between critical thinking and tactical execution within a fast-paced environment
  • Experience with Employer Branding within the tech industry
  • Vendor management + contract negotiation experience 
  • Experience using an ATS system (Greenhouse preferred), reporting tools, and sourcing tools
